please help with CA smog

hello ,
my car failed smog 2 days ago it is 92 with 5.0 tbi and i need help to figure out my options

overall results
comrehensive visual inspection:PASS
functional check:Failed
emission test: PASS

emission control system visual inspection/ functional check results
all of these things passed
pcv,catalytic converter, egr visual,fuel cap visual,spark controls,thermostatic air cleaner,air injection,vacuum lined to sensors/switches,ingntion timing:tdc, wiring to sensors, fuel evap contro0ls, check engine light, carb fuel injection,other emision related components, oxygen sensor, and liquid fuel leaks.

Failed
fuel cap functional
fuel evap controls functional

N/A
Egr functional
fillpipe restrictor

Asm Emission test results
15mph pass
the only section that was kind of low was CO% max0.50 ave 0.06 meas 0.02
25mph pass CO% max 0.41 ave 0.05 meas 0.01

smog guy said i need new gas cap
and some rubber lines mine where cracked i beleave it was to the fuel canister location:front d-side by head light black cylinder.... not real problem here...

my problem he also said that i need to have a hose hooked up from thermostatic snorkle (air cleaner) to the exhaust manifold.. from what i read it hepsl the carb warm up so it doesnt run cold for so long....

i have the hose but the manifold heat shield is not on my engine at all i can not find one anywhere so i have nowhere to hook the hose up to.

does anyone no where i can get just the shield without the whole exhaust manifold? plan to hit up a few junk yards if all else fails

or
is there any alternatives to the air cleaner such as open element filter?
will it pass ca smog? if i use a different air cleaner with no thermostatic snorkle will it still fail.. im guessing that if he didnt see the thermostatic snorkle and the whole on the bottum of it there would be know reason to think something was missing..

i see other engines all the time without this part and some with it. how are they getting around smog if in ca

Open element won't pass visual.

The heat stove is riveted together around the exhaust manifold. Not likely to find it by itself (but you may).

A '92 doesn't have a carb. Should be TBI (assuming you have an RS & V8).

Every stock TBI Chevy I have seen had a Thermac.
Could be; I could easily be wrong about that. I avoid even looking at those almost as carefully as 6-cyl ones.

If it came with it, you have basically no option whatsoever other than to replace the manifold with one that some doof hasn't already senselessly hacked the heat stove off of. I know of no way to get the heat shield separately. Not sure what other manifolds (e.g. truck TBI 350) might fit, might have to get a new one. Check 1AAuto and PartsPros and places like that.
